What Exactly Is a Mass Tort Lawyer Does
A mass tort lawyer is a legal professional who fights on behalf of harmed consumers whose damages were caused by a single responsible party — typically a pharmaceutical company. Unlike a class action, where every claimant are treated as a single unit, mass tort cases permit individual claimants to pursue separate damages based on personal losses they suffered. This difference is highly significant because not every person sustain the same injuries from the same drug.
Mechanically, mass tort litigation often starts when legal teams identify a pattern of damage caused by a specific product or substance. Your mass tort lawyer will collect documentation including diagnostic reports, expert testimony, and manufacturer records to prove fault. Cases are often coordinated in federal court under a system known as Multidistrict Litigation, or MDL, which speeds up pre-trial proceedings.
The investigation phase demands a thorough knowledge of both scientific evidence and complex procedural rules. The Mass Tort Lawyer Process Step by Step
- The Introductory Case Review — Everything opens with a complimentary evaluation where a mass tort lawyer examines what happened to you. This session is used to figure out whether your losses could stem from a known harmful product.
- Building Your Evidence File — Once retained, your mass tort lawyer immediately begins collecting medical records, prescription histories, and wage documentation that define the full extent of your physical and financial suffering.
- Building the Causation Argument — The legal team enlists independent professionals in pharmacology, science, and product design to link your diagnosed conditions directly to the company's conduct.
- Submitting Your Claim — Your case is submitted with the proper jurisdiction and, where applicable, joined with an existing MDL proceeding. That phase guarantees your claim benefits from shared discovery already gathered across other victims.
- Gathering Corporate Evidence — During discovery, your mass tort lawyer demands manufacturer records that reveal what the company knew and when they knew it. Witness testimony from company insiders can generate powerful evidence that bolster your position.
- Pursuing the Best Outcome — Most mass tort cases resolve through settlement, but our team prepares every case as though a jury will decide it. That preparation leads to higher compensation because corporations understand we are ready.
- Closing Out Your Case — When compensation is awarded, your mass tort lawyer explains the distribution process, handles the financial accounting transparently, and ensures you understand exactly what you are receiving.

Mass Tort Lawyer FAQ
How long does a mass tort case typically take?Complex tort litigation require more time than typical accident claims. Based on how far along of the coordinating litigation, a case can resolve anywhere from a couple of years to a decade after your claim is submitted. Our team will provide regular case updates so you are always informed.
Does a mass tort case always end up in court?An overwhelming percentage of mass tort claims conclude through negotiated agreements. That said, preparing as if the case will go before a jury tends to result in more favorable resolutions. Should litigation move forward, your mass tort lawyer is trained and equipped to argue on your behalf.
What kinds of injuries qualify for mass tort litigation?Covered harm can include serious illnesses tied to defective drugs, cardiovascular complications from recalled medications, and respiratory illness from industrial toxins. A mass tort lawyer examines your diagnosis to assess if your health problems align with reported injuries from the material in question.

Can I still file a mass tort claim if I am not part of a class action?Absolutely — mass tort and class action are distinct litigation frameworks. With class certification, every claimant are treated identically. Through the mass tort process, every victim keeps a separate, individual claim built around the unique facts of your situation. That individualized approach tends to be more beneficial for victims with serious, documented injuries.
